Трюгве Реенскауг - Trygve Reenskaug
Трюгве Реенскауг | |
---|---|
Трюгве Реенскауг в 2010 году | |
Родился | 21 июня 1930 г. |
Национальность | норвежский язык |
Известен | модель – представление – контроллер , Объектно-ориентированный ролевой анализ и моделирование , Персональное программирование |
Научная карьера | |
Поля | Информатика |
Учреждения | Sentralinstitutt for Industrial forskning , Xerox PARC, Таскон Universitetet i Oslo |
Трюгве Миккель Хейердал Реенскауг (родился 21 июня 1930 г.) норвежский язык компьютерный ученый и почетный профессор Университет Осло. Он сформулировал модель – представление – контроллер (MVC) шаблон для графический интерфейс пользователя (GUI) разработка программного обеспечения в 1979 году во время посещения Исследовательский центр Xerox в Пало-Альто (ПАРК). Его первый крупный программный проект «Autokon» создал успешную программу CAD / CAM, которая была впервые использована в 1963 году и продолжала использоваться верфями по всему миру более 30 лет.
Реенскауг описал свое раннее Болтовня и объектно-ориентированные концептуальные усилия следующим образом:[1]
MVC был задуман как общее решение проблемы пользователей, управляющих большим и сложным набором данных. Самым сложным было найти хорошие имена для различных архитектурных компонентов. Model-View-Editor был первым набором. После долгих дискуссий, особенно с Адель Голдберг, мы закончили терминами Модель-Представление-Контроллер.
Он активно участвовал в исследованиях объектно-ориентированный методы и разработали Объектно-ориентированный ролевой анализ и моделирование (OOram) и инструмент OOram в 1983 году. Он основал компанию информационных технологий. Таскон в 1986 году, который разработал инструменты на основе OOram. Идеи OOram воплотились в жизнь и существенно переросли в проект BabyUML, кульминацией которого стало создание Данные, контекст и взаимодействие (DCI) парадигма.
Реенскауг написал книгу Работа с объектами: метод разработки программного обеспечения OOram с соавторами Пером Уолдом и Оддом Арильдом Лене.[2]Позже он написал виртуальную машину для Единый язык моделирования (UML). В настоящее время[Обновить] он Заслуженный профессор в отставке информатики на Университет Осло.
Рекомендации
- ^ "MVC: XEROX PARC 1978-79". Архивировано из оригинал на 2018-04-25.
- ^ Реенскауг, Трюгве; Пер Уолд; Нечетный Арильд Лене (июнь 1995 г.). Работа с объектами: метод разработки программного обеспечения OOram (PDF). Прентис Холл. ISBN 978-0-13-452930-1. Архивировано из оригинал (PDF) на 2018-04-25. Получено 18 апреля, 2010.
внешняя ссылка
- Веб-сайт Тригве Реенскауг в Университете Осло в Архив-Это (заархивировано 25 апреля 2018 г.)
- Реенскауг, Трюгве; (с разными соавторами). «Избранные публикации и книги с 1970 года».
- Реенскауг, Трюгве (Университет Осло, соучредитель: Таскон); и Одд Арильд Лене (соучредитель: Taskon) «Учебник 25: Работа с объектами: использование и повторное использование с анализом и синтезом ролевой модели; (описание учебного пособия OOPSLA '96)». OOSPLA96 (Конференция по объектно-ориентированному программированию, системам, языкам и приложениям, 1996 г.).
- Рупп, Н. Алекс (11 декабря 2003 г.). «Часть первая: история паттерна MVC». Java.net. Архивировано из оригинал 29 мая 2007 г. (Часть статьи, озаглавленной: «Помимо MVC: новый взгляд на инфраструктуру сервлетов»)
- Список публикаций Трюгве Реенскауг в CRIStin